We have tested and proven installations right across the globe with proven capabilities in air purification and odour abatement in a wide variety of sectors including: Wastewater Treatment Industry | Food/Agri Industry | Municipal Solid Waste | Pharmaceutical/Petro Chemical/Printing‭ & ‬Coating/Other Industries.‬‬‬‬ Mónafil™ Control of hydrogen sulfide and VOCs is a concern in many wastewater treatment, composting and industrial plants. Hydrogen sulfide, and many VOC’s, create odours, are corrosive, cause air pollution and are detrimental to health. Mónafil™ is a patented biofiltration system that uses special media as a capture and support medium offering excellent removal efficiencies for odours, VOC’s, sulfur and nitrogen-based compounds. The properties of the manufactured granular high-density peat media have proven to be a key factor in achieving high performance removal and media life up to 10 years. Mónafil™ has been successfully used in odour control applications for more than 20 years. Mónashell™ The Mónashell™ biofiltration system is a proven and cost-effective alternative to chemical scrubbing or carbon adsorption, designed like a biotrickling system yet incorporating many benefits of traditional biofilters. The shell-based media is sustainable and renewable with the ability to maintain a neutral pH within the biofilter. This ensures optimal odour performance across a broad range of odour producing compounds, while simplifying operation and enhancing system reliability. Control of odour-causing compounds emitted from wastewater and industrial treatment processes has become a growing area of concern. As populations grow and housing encroaches on once-remote treatment facilities, the importance of effective, yet simple odour control technology will continue to increase. In addition, odourous compounds can be corrosive to equipment requiring ventilation to extend equipment life and reduce capital replacement expenditure. Mónasorb™ Control of hydrogen sulfide and VOCs is a concern in many wastewater treatment, composting and industrial plants. Hydrogen sulfide, and many VOC’s, create odours, are corrosive, cause air pollution and are detrimental to health. Mónasorb™ is a range of Carbon Filter systems that uses activated carbon, impregnated carbon as a capture and support medium, offering excellent removal efficiencies for odours, VOC’s, sulfur and nitrogen-based compounds. Our carbon units may be used as a standalone filter or as a polishing filter for a Mónashell™ OCU’s for even greater levels of treatment.

    Solids Technology International was established in 1979 in Dublin, Ireland to develop high-performance belt filter dewatering equipment and innovative solutions for the water and wastewater industry. In 2002 the company was taken over by Kent Stainless. The manufacturing facility includes 3D laser cutting, CNC sheet, electro-polishing and bead blasting finishing plants. Employing over 100 people and resources including over 50 people with mechanical or electrical trades and over 20 design engineers working utilising 3D design packages gives Solids Technology the capability to supply turnkey thickening, dewatering and poly preparation solutions. Today there are over 800 Solids Technology belt filter systems worldwide and are one of the leaders within the marketplace for Stainless steel, fully enclosed, automated high-performance dewatering and thickening system. Our product range includes: Filter Belt Presses, Gravity Belt Thickeners, Poly Preparation Systems.

Our technologies include: Nitreat® Ion Exchange: This is a reversible nitrate removal process by which ions are interchanged between a solid and a liquid with no substantial structural changes in the solid. AquaPyr™ Tertiary Solids Removal Filter: This process is a simple filter that can also remove phosphorous using innovative cleaning technology producing low waste and using less power than other filters. Amtreat® High Rate Ammonia Removal: This process is a high-rate activated sludge process designed to treat wastewater streams and sludge liquors containing high concentrations of ammonia.
